February 2021
- Helm Form available in the Developer Catalog
-
The Helm Form is now available in the Developer Catalog of the web console of the OpenShift Container Platform version 4.6. You can now easily configure the properties in the YAML files by using the Helm Form.
- Red Hat® OpenShift Container Platform dashboard experience
-
You can now view the high level information about your OpenShift Container Platform clusters from the OpenShift Container Platform web console.
- Support to configure the time-zone of the application environment
-
You can now configure the time-zone of the environment in which the applications are run. You can set the value of the global.timeZone property in the Helm chart to the appropriate time-zone. For example, the value of the property can be America/Chicago. For more information about the supported values of time-zone, see Time-zone IDs.
- Support to run custom scripts after the IBM Sterling Configurator server starts
-
You can now run your custom scripts after the Sterling Configurator starts, by running the ocpostappready.sh file that is available in the /charts/ibm-cpq-prod/scripts folder.
- Support to disable the deployment of IBM Sterling Configurator user interface
-
You now have the choice to disable the deployment of the Sterling Configurator UI in your environments based on your business requirements. You can set the value of the deployConfiguratorUI property as false to disable the deployment.
October 2020
- Support to run Visual Modeler database migration scripts
-
The Visual Modeler data setup job is enhanced to run the database migration scripts when you migrate to a new fix pack. You must set the following properties in the values.yaml file for the migration scripts to run.
- vmdatasetup.migrateDB.enabled
- vmdatasetup.migrateDB.fromFPVersion
- vmdatasetup.migrateDB.toFPVersion
- Support to turn off the Swagger UI and the API documentation
-
You can now turn off the Swagger UI and the API documentation by using the IBM Sterling Configurator deployment chart. By default, the Swagger UI and the API documentation is turned on. You can set the ocappserver.swagger.enabled property to false to turn them off.
- Pod logs available outside the pods
-
The pod logs are now available outside the pods to simplify the process of checking logs. You can now check the logs in the repository without navigating in the pods.
- Support to run pods with arbitrary user IDs
-
The pods that are deployed on Red Hat OpenShift Container Platform, now run by using the IDs that are provided by OpenShift cluster.

- Performance improvement
- The in-memory EhCache is implemented in OmniConfigurator for improved performance. The EhCache works in a distributed mode and
uses the Remote Method Invocation replication to support multiple Pods.
